Output 450f6dcaaf23c6018dbe1876825f0c16aeb75b31571156dd75eeeb0d2b8d84f8:21

value
672428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74a09e6898f289595f3af7616ff9fe782e84dc80 OP_EQUAL
address
3CKginUMVVSuRrySjeMQy8Vb4NhLDHK43R
transaction
450f6dcaaf23c6018dbe1876825f0c16aeb75b31571156dd75eeeb0d2b8d84f8
spent
true